Bass Island is a nature reserve in Maine, at a recorded 1 m. Bauneg Beg Mountain stands 262 m to the west, 18 miles off. The nearest named place is Pinkham Island, a nature reserve 0.3 miles away. Coastal Byway passes 25 miles off.
